Tas Firefighters fear further arson attacks

14 January 2008

published by www.abc.net.au


Australia — Tasmania fire crews are creating fire breaks around the Clarendon Vale foothills east of Hobart to guard against arson attacks.

A bushfire in the area had threatened homes on Friday, but fire crews managed to contain it over the weekend.

The Fire Service says it’s pleased with how well people have prepared their properties.

The Incident Controller for the Hobart area, John Green says a bulldozer is being used to create a fall-back position for crews in case another fire is lit.

“Unfortunately yes, from past experience we’ve had a lot of fire activity in that area from various reasons,” he said.

“Most of which have been suspicious in the past so we need to ensure that we’ve got adequate safe edges to protect the public.”

The Fire Service says a bushfire at Goshen, near St Helens on the east coast has burnt more than 200 hectares, but no homes are threatened at this stage.
